Buffersize Problems HELP!!
My Pro Tools system is working fine when in mix mode, I can easily mix with a fair amount of heavy plugins, but to my extreme horror, today when I tryed to record "4 track" test all I got was an "increase buffer size" and "decrease buffer size" answer; it happens on both 24 and 16 bit sessions, although in 16 bit mode I can record dead air as long as I don't feed it audio;When I doit, it stops saying that PT holded interrupts for too long (- 9093); What does it mean? It is extremely strange not to be able to record 4 tracks on a 1800XP Athlon with 512 Mb Ram and Asus A7m266 Motherboard.

Re: Buffersize Problems HELP!!
gerax:
The same thing happened to me! Try this. Save the session as a copy in 16 bit. This should solve the problem. When I bounced some tracks to disc at 24 bit, and brought them back into the session, I began to have the same errors. However, once I saved a copy of the same session at 16 bit, the problem went away. My friend told me not to record or bounce to disc using 24 bit and now I know why. I hope this helps. Re: Buffersize Problems HELP!!
This may be of no help, but sometimes you get this error message when it seems like buffer size has nothing to do with the problem. A couple examples (for me anyways) are when you fast forward or rewind and then hit play, or sometimes using the '2 bars' option when midi recording.
